找回密码
 立即注册

QQ登录

只需一步,快速开始

欣欣呀

注册会员

13

主题

20

帖子

117

积分

注册会员

积分
117
欣欣呀
注册会员   /  发表于:2023-11-27 15:56  /   查看:3027  /  回复:3
1金币
image.png325387267.png


image.png185775756.png
image.png235293883.png
winform SpreadJ15
FpSpread1.ActiveSheet.Cells.Get(i, 39).Formula中有当前操作的单元格的话
操作当前单元格 触发的model1_Changed的e.RowCount  e.ColumnCount是所有的列和行 不是当前修改的列和行
这是什么原因

3 个回复

倒序浏览
Richard.Ma讲师达人认证 悬赏达人认证 SpreadJS 开发认证
超级版主   /  发表于:2023-11-27 17:53:47
沙发
是的,这个事件本身提供的参数确实就所有被影响的单元格的一个范围

你要是想要捕获本身变化,可以用
fpSpread1.Change事件
回复 使用道具 举报
欣欣呀
注册会员   /  发表于:2023-11-27 18:15:49
板凳
Richard.Ma 发表于 2023-11-27 17:53
是的,这个事件本身提供的参数确实就所有被影响的单元格的一个范围

你要是想要捕获本身变化,可以用

我用10的版的就是OK的 15版本 的不行 还有就是只有是单元格有Formula的会有问题 这是是升级之后的结果吗
回复 使用道具 举报
Richard.Ma讲师达人认证 悬赏达人认证 SpreadJS 开发认证
超级版主   /  发表于:2023-11-28 13:57:33
地板
本帖最后由 Richard.Ma 于 2023-12-31 09:43 编辑

嗯,V12版本后,这块功能有了变更,请使用spread.Change即可
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部